We provide skilled nursing and subacute care for a wide variety of patients who are referred to us by case managers and physicians in the Willis Knighton network. We also admit patients from other local and regional health systems, including Ochsner LSU Health Shreveport and Christus Highland, but priority is given to referrals from the Willis Knighton network.

Patients admitted to our facility typically need close medical supervision and 24-hour care on a short-term basis (typically two to four weeks*).

We accept patients who are:

  • Facing medically complex conditions, including those who are recovering from surgery, as well as those who require wound care or physical therapy. Access to dialysis, including transportation, is also provided. (Note: Exceptions are made for those who have a new PEG tube or extended cancer treatments.)
  • Age 18 or older
  • Usually able to follow commands
  • Able to make significant functional improvement
  • Usually able to tolerate and willing to participate in daily therapy

*Patients may apply for Medicaid in order to extend their stay at PCC.
